Class Commission
java.lang.Object
com.softlayer.api.Type
com.softlayer.api.service.Entity
com.softlayer.api.service.container.referral.partner.Commission
@ApiType("SoftLayer_Container_Referral_Partner_Commission") public class Commission extends Entity
-
Nested Class Summary
Nested Classes Modifier and Type Class Description static class
Commission.Mask
-
Field Summary
Fields Modifier and Type Field Description protected BigDecimal
commissionAmount
protected boolean
commissionAmountSpecified
protected BigDecimal
commissionRate
protected boolean
commissionRateSpecified
protected GregorianCalendar
createDate
protected boolean
createDateSpecified
protected Long
referralAccountId
protected boolean
referralAccountIdSpecified
protected String
referralCompanyName
protected boolean
referralCompanyNameSpecified
protected Long
referralPartnerAccountId
protected boolean
referralPartnerAccountIdSpecified
protected BigDecimal
referralRevenue
protected boolean
referralRevenueSpecified
-
Constructor Summary
Constructors Constructor Description Commission()
-
Method Summary
-
Field Details
-
commissionAmount
-
commissionAmountSpecified
protected boolean commissionAmountSpecified -
commissionRate
-
commissionRateSpecified
protected boolean commissionRateSpecified -
createDate
-
createDateSpecified
protected boolean createDateSpecified -
referralAccountId
-
referralAccountIdSpecified
protected boolean referralAccountIdSpecified -
referralCompanyName
-
referralCompanyNameSpecified
protected boolean referralCompanyNameSpecified -
referralPartnerAccountId
-
referralPartnerAccountIdSpecified
protected boolean referralPartnerAccountIdSpecified -
referralRevenue
-
referralRevenueSpecified
protected boolean referralRevenueSpecified
-
-
Constructor Details
-
Commission
public Commission()
-
-
Method Details
-
getCommissionAmount
-
setCommissionAmount
-
isCommissionAmountSpecified
public boolean isCommissionAmountSpecified() -
unsetCommissionAmount
public void unsetCommissionAmount() -
getCommissionRate
-
setCommissionRate
-
isCommissionRateSpecified
public boolean isCommissionRateSpecified() -
unsetCommissionRate
public void unsetCommissionRate() -
getCreateDate
-
setCreateDate
-
isCreateDateSpecified
public boolean isCreateDateSpecified() -
unsetCreateDate
public void unsetCreateDate() -
getReferralAccountId
-
setReferralAccountId
-
isReferralAccountIdSpecified
public boolean isReferralAccountIdSpecified() -
unsetReferralAccountId
public void unsetReferralAccountId() -
getReferralCompanyName
-
setReferralCompanyName
-
isReferralCompanyNameSpecified
public boolean isReferralCompanyNameSpecified() -
unsetReferralCompanyName
public void unsetReferralCompanyName() -
getReferralPartnerAccountId
-
setReferralPartnerAccountId
-
isReferralPartnerAccountIdSpecified
public boolean isReferralPartnerAccountIdSpecified() -
unsetReferralPartnerAccountId
public void unsetReferralPartnerAccountId() -
getReferralRevenue
-
setReferralRevenue
-
isReferralRevenueSpecified
public boolean isReferralRevenueSpecified() -
unsetReferralRevenue
public void unsetReferralRevenue()
-